Transaction b80f93d13115ce60a0b4d52b8e44048a3710f392569463a5040d47e66e3a5357
1 Input
2 Outputs
- b80f93d13115ce60a0b4d52b8e44048a3710f392569463a5040d47e66e3a5357:0
- b80f93d13115ce60a0b4d52b8e44048a3710f392569463a5040d47e66e3a5357:1
value 313485563
address 1FEgoo7MgpwN3rcq7bEQPeKJUG9UEErWM4
value 5000000
address 12rhCsW3tEE2SSsFWoXZCsCpuJgAbHcr7j